  • Whooping Crane Population Loss

    Whooping Crane Population Loss
    The whooping crane population dropped to an all-time low of 21 birds in 1944, raising some of the first modern concerns for population depletion and possible extinction.

  • Act Amended

    Congress passes amendment to the Endangered Species Preservation Act that prevetns the importation and sale within the United States of species at risk of worldwide extinction.
  • Endangered Species Act

    Endangered Species Act
    Congress passes the Endangered Species Act of 1973.
